What is artificial pollination?
Artificial pollination involves the manual application of pollen to plants. This is considered an alternative to insect-assisted pollination. Think about you being the pollination agent. It only takes carrying the pollen from the male to the female plant.
Types of manual pollination
There are two types of artificial pollination.
- Hand pollination
- Mechanical pollination
1. Hand pollination
This is pollination done by hand. The use of a brush is an easy way of doing it. The pollen is collected with the brush and applied manually on the female flower. This type is a common vegetable plant with separate male and female parts.
Hand pollination is best done in the morning when the flowers bloom. It is mainly used in small home gardens.
Plants that are easy to hand-pollinate include pumpkins, melons, and squash. They are plants that bloom and open their flowers wide for easier access when hand pollinating.
The process is straightforward for any gardener. All you need is to swab the inside of a male flower.
Then you move and swab the inside of a female flower using the same brush of cotton swab. But you have to observe keenly to ensure that the pollen is transferred.
2. Mechanical pollination
Mechanical pollination is also done manually. It also engaged human intervention. The pollen has to be collected and transferred to the flowers where needed. However, it is done in a more efficient way than hand pollination.
Mechanical pollination is most common for plants such as tomatoes, pepper, and beans. They are also self-pollinating.
A common way of mechanical pollination is using a fan. The wind from the fan forces the plant to see the pollen. It then drops from the stamen to the stigma.
Can you pollinate your plants manually?
There is no doubt that you can pollinate plants by hand. This is considered an appropriate way of assisting your plants.
All you have to do is find the best way of carrying the pollen from one flower to another. The process is achievable using two simple steps.
Step 1: Remove the petals
The first step is to remove the petals of a male flower. It is recommended not to touch the flower part with bare hands. It can transfer the pollen to the fingers and lead to failure.
Step 2: Transfer the pollen
The next step is to transfer the pollen. Push back the petals of blooming female flowers. They move the stamens of the male flower.
Move the stamens gently as you touch the stigma of the female flower. The pollen is easily moved, and pollination occurs.
Benefits of manual pollination
Artificial pollination is used mostly when there is a need for mass pollination. It is recommended for gardeners who intend to increase the number of fruits. This is because natural pollination comes with limitations. It is dependent on the activity of the pollination agents.
There are many cases where flowering does not mean automatic harvest. This is because of insufficient pollination. Pollinating your plants manually means greater control over the production process.
Manual pollination is also great for altering the genetic population of crops. It is used when gardeners look out for an improved breed. But it requires significant research.
The process may also be used to prevent cross-pollination. This is when a gardener wants to retain a similar breed of their liking.
